HP Pro 3330, 3400, 3405 memory upgrade

This 4GB DDR3 1333 module is built for HP Pro 3330, 3400 and 3405 desktops and workstations. It delivers a single 4GB DIMM running at PC3-10600 speed with CL9 latency and 1.5V operation. The unbuffered, non-ECC design matches the original system requirements. It suits owners of those specific HP models who need a straightforward capacity increase.

JEDEC and RoHS compliance changes the risk profile

The module meets JEDEC standards and is RoHS compliant, so it qualifies as a warranty-safe upgrade for the supported HP systems. OWC tests every unit in-house before shipment, reducing the chance of a defective stick. The advanced replacement programme and lifetime warranty with free tech support add a safety net that pure commodity memory often lacks.

Green PCB, no heat spreader, standard 240-pin layout

The stick uses a plain green circuit board without a heat spreader, keeping the profile low for tight chassis clearance. Gold-edge contacts on the 240-pin DDR3 interface ensure reliable seating in the motherboard slots. Builders who need ECC, registered signalling, or higher voltages cannot use this module; it is strictly non-ECC unbuffered at 1.5V.
